3 Color Palette Generator for 60-30-10 rule


Generate three color palette that work well together and can be used as the primary, secondary, and accent colors in your design. By using just three colors, you can create a sense of balance and simplicity, while still allowing for plenty of creativity. The 60-30-10 rule is a popular guideline for using three-color palettes in design. According to this rule, 60% of your design should be made up of the dominant color, 30% should be the secondary color, and 10% should be the accent color.


4 Color Palette Generator


Four color palettes offer more flexibility and complexity in design than three-color palettes. With four colors, you can create a wider range of moods and styles, while still maintaining balance and harmony. One common way to use a four-color palette is to choose a dominant color, two supporting colors, and an accent color. The dominant color should be the main color in your design, while the supporting colors should complement it. The accent color can be used to add a pop of color and draw attention to certain elements, just as in a three-color palette.

Six-color palettes provide even more flexibility and complexity in design than four-color palettes. With six colors, you can create a wide range of moods and styles, while still maintaining balance and harmony. One way to use a six-color palette is to choose a dominant color, two supporting colors, and three accent colors. Another way to use a six-color palette is to choose three sets of complementary colors. For example, you might choose blue and orange as one set, green and purple as another set, and yellow and red as a third set. When used together, these colors can create a sense of vibrancy and energy, while still maintaining balance.
